Early praise for Exile in Guyville


Exile in Guyville has earned some early praise:


"Amy Lee Lillard's Exile in Guyville takes you on a deeply poetic journey of women in exile. Women out of time, women out of place, women out of their minds, and women out of luck leap from this haunting, beautiful, slender short story collection that stays with you long after you close the book. This is a terrific collection of sneakily powerful writing and an unfettered, wild imagination."

Chelsea G. Summers, author of A Certain Hunger


"Lillard’s collection is explosive and inventive, balancing humor and horror as each story explores the ways in which women’s identities are built, broken, and rebuilt. I would happily be exiled with these complicated, stubborn, fierce, indomitable women!" Gwen E. Kirby, author of Shit Cassandra Saw


The collection will be published in Spring 2024. Stay tuned for much more!
